DESIGN/BUILD AERIAL DELIVERY ADDITION, KIRTLAND AIR FORCE BASE, BERNALILLO COUNTY, NEW MEXICO. The proposed procurement is a competitive HubZone set aside. Only offers from qualified HubZone business concerns (as determined by the Small Business Association) will be accepted. Offers received from concerns that are not certified by the SBA shall be considered non-responsive and will be rejected. This acquisition is a Best Value Request for Proposal (RFP). NAICS code is 236990/SIC 1542, with a size standard of $33,500,000.00. The magnitude of construction is between $1,000,000.00 and $5,000,000.00. Bonding will be required for this acquisition. Offerors attention is directed to Section 00100 in the Solicitation for information regarding a tour of the site. The Solicitation will be issued on or about November 3, 2010 with proposals due on or about December 9, 2010. This solicitation will not be issued on paper. WORK CONSISTS of the design and construction of three additions to the existing building 994 located on Kirtland Air Force Base to include a new parachute drying tower, additional office space and additional warehouse space. Project includes site work and will be LEED Silver. This project will be advertised as a Hub-Zone set-aside Best Value Request for Proposal (RFP). Competitive proposals will be evaluated based on the evaluation criteria set forth in the solicitation package. Evaluation by the Government will result in selection of a firm that represents the best overall value to the Government. Proposed procurement will result in a firm fixed price contract.
